    DESCRIPTION

    American Financial Group, Inc., an insurance holding company, provides specialty property and casualty insurance products in the United States. It offers property and transportation insurance products, such as physical damage and liability coverage for buses and trucks, inland and ocean marine, agricultural-related products, and other commercial property and specialty transportation coverages; specialty casualty insurance, including primarily excess and surplus, executive and professional liability, general liability, umbrella and excess liability, and specialty coverage in targeted markets, as well as customized programs for small to mid-sized businesses and workers' compensation insurance; and specialty financial insurance products comprising risk management insurance programs for lending and leasing institutions, fidelity and surety products, and trade credit insurance. The company sells its property and casualty insurance products through independent insurance agents and brokers. American Financial Group, Inc. was founded in 1872 and is headquartered in Cincinnati, Ohio.

    American Financial Group, Inc. Announces the Offering of $350 Million of Senior Notes

    businesswire.com

    2025-09-16 17:34:00

    CINCINNATI--(BUSINESS WIRE)--American Financial Group, Inc. (NYSE: AFG) announced today the registered offering of $350 million of 5.0% Senior Notes (the “Notes”) due September 23, 2035. The Notes were priced at 99.162% of their principal amount. The Company intends to use the approximately $344 million of net proceeds from this offering for general corporate purposes, which may include repurchases of AFG's outstanding common shares.     American Financial Group: Another Mixed Quarter (Rating Downgrade)

    seekingalpha.com

    2025-08-07 22:04:53

    AFG's recent results were mixed, with weaker underwriting and disappointing alternative investment returns, leading me to downgrade my rating to 'hold.' Premium inflation is decelerating, likely signaling peak margins for the insurance sector and making it harder for AFG to improve its combined ratio. Investment income from fixed income remains solid, but alternative returns and rental growth are muted, and a key asset sale fell through, limiting upside.
